.modal.svelte-1yidkcn{border:var(--border);border-radius:var(--radius);box-shadow:var(--shadow-sm);transition:display .6s allow-discrete,overlay .6s allow-discrete;animation:svelte-1yidkcn-closeModal .6s forwards}.modal[open].svelte-1yidkcn{animation:svelte-1yidkcn-openModal 1s forwards}.modal[open].svelte-1yidkcn::backdrop{animation:svelte-1yidkcn-fadeIn .6s forwards}.modal.svelte-1yidkcn::backdrop{background:#00000040;-webkit-backdrop-filter:var(--filter-blur);backdrop-filter:var(--filter-blur);animation:svelte-1yidkcn-fadeOut 1s forwards}.modal_center.svelte-1yidkcn{--open-modal-from: translate(-50%, -100%);--open-modal: translate(-50%, -50%);--close-modal-to: translate(-50%, 0);top:50%;left:50%}.modal_center.svelte-1yidkcn .modal__content:where(.svelte-1yidkcn){padding:var(--indent)}.modal_center.svelte-1yidkcn .modal__header:where(.svelte-1yidkcn){text-align:center;padding:0 var(--indent)}.modal_left.svelte-1yidkcn{--open-modal-from: translate(-50%, -50%);--open-modal: translate(0, -50%);--close-modal-to: translate(-50%, -50%);top:50%;height:100%;border-top-left-radius:0;border-bottom-left-radius:0}.modal_left.svelte-1yidkcn>.modal__content:where(.svelte-1yidkcn){padding:var(--indent-double)}.modal_left.svelte-1yidkcn .modal__body:where(.svelte-1yidkcn){flex:1}.modal__header.svelte-1yidkcn{display:flex;gap:var(--indent-half);align-items:center;justify-content:center;min-height:2rem}.modal__content.svelte-1yidkcn{display:flex;flex-direction:column;gap:var(--indent);position:relative;height:100%}.modal__close.svelte-1yidkcn{position:absolute;top:var(--indent-half);right:var(--indent-half);background-color:var(--color-border);padding:var(--indent-quarter);border-radius:var(--radius-full);transition:background-color var(--transition-base)}.modal__close.svelte-1yidkcn:hover{background-color:var(--gray)}.modal__message.svelte-1yidkcn{display:flex;flex-direction:column;text-align:center;gap:var(--indent-half);color:var(--color-text-secondary)}.modal__buttons.svelte-1yidkcn{display:flex;flex-wrap:wrap;gap:var(--indent);justify-content:center}@keyframes svelte-1yidkcn-fadeIn{0%{opacity:0}to{opacity:1}}@keyframes svelte-1yidkcn-fadeOut{0%{opacity:1}to{opacity:0}}@keyframes svelte-1yidkcn-openModal{0%{opacity:0;transform:var(--open-modal-from)}to{opacity:1;transform:var(--open-modal)}}@keyframes svelte-1yidkcn-closeModal{0%{opacity:1;transform:var(--open-modal)}to{opacity:0;transform:var(--close-modal-to)}}.button.svelte-18sv61c{--button-color: transparent;background-color:var(--button-color);color:var(--color-white);padding:var(--indent-half) var(--indent-three-quarters);border-radius:var(--radius);transition:background-color var(--transition-base),color var(--transition-base),transform var(--transition-fast)}.button.svelte-18sv61c:focus{outline:none}.button.svelte-18sv61c:focus-visible{box-shadow:0 0 0 2px var(--color-white),0 0 0 4px var(--color-primary)}.button[disabled].svelte-18sv61c{opacity:.5;cursor:not-allowed}@media(hover:hover){.button.svelte-18sv61c:not(.button_outline,.button_ghost):hover:not(:disabled){background-color:hsl(from var(--button-color) h s calc(l - 10))}}@media(hover:none){.button.svelte-18sv61c:not(.button_outline,.button_ghost):active:not(:disabled){background-color:hsl(from var(--button-color) h s calc(l - 10))}}.button:active:not[disabled].svelte-18sv61c{transform:scale(.95)}.button_elevated.svelte-18sv61c{box-shadow:var(--shadow-sm)}.button_primary.svelte-18sv61c{--button-color: var(--color-primary)}.button_secondary.svelte-18sv61c{--button-color: var(--color-secondary)}.button_danger.svelte-18sv61c{--button-color: var(--color-danger)}.button_success.svelte-18sv61c{--button-color: var(--color-success)}.button_gray.svelte-18sv61c{--button-color: var(--lightgray);color:inherit}.button_ghost.svelte-18sv61c{--ghost-bg-color: transparent;--ghost-txt-color: var(--button-color);background-color:var(--ghost-bg-color);color:var(--ghost-txt-color)}@media(hover:hover){.button_ghost.svelte-18sv61c:hover:not(:disabled){--ghost-bg-color: color-mix(in srgb, var(--ghost-txt-color) 30%, var(--color-white))}}@media(hover:none){.button_ghost.svelte-18sv61c:active:not(:disabled){--ghost-bg-color: color-mix(in srgb, var(--ghost-txt-color) 30%, var(--color-white))}}.button_outline.svelte-18sv61c{--outline-bg-color: transparent;--outline-txt-color: var(--button-color);background-color:var(--outline-bg-color);color:var(--outline-txt-color);border:1px solid var(--outline-txt-color)}@media(hover:hover){.button_outline.svelte-18sv61c:hover:not(:disabled){--outline-bg-color: var(--outline-txt-color);color:var(--color-white)}}@media(hover:none){.button_outline.svelte-18sv61c:active:not(:disabled){--outline-bg-color: var(--outline-txt-color);color:var(--color-white)}}
